Win32_Condition class

The Win32_Condition WMI class represents the criteria used to determine the selection state of any entry in the Win32_SoftwareFeature class, based on a conditional expression. If Win32_Condition evaluates to True, the corresponding feature is installed at the level specified by the Level property. Using this mechanism, any feature can be permanently disabled (by setting Level to 0 [zero]), set to be always installed (by setting Level to 1), or set to a different install priority (by setting Level to an intermediate value). The level may be determined based upon any conditional statement, such as a test for platform, operating system, a particular property setting, and so on.

The following syntax is simplified from Managed Object Format (MOF) code and includes all inherited properties. Properties and methods are in alphabetic order, not MOF order.

Syntax

[Provider("MSIProv"), Dynamic]
class Win32_Condition : CIM_Check
{
  string  Caption;
  string  CheckID;
  boolean CheckMode;
  string  Condition;
  string  Description;
  string  Feature;
  uint16  Level;
  string  Name;
  string  SoftwareElementID;
  uint16  SoftwareElementState;
  uint16  TargetOperatingSystem;
  string  Version;
};

Members

The Win32_Condition class has these types of members:

Methods

The Win32_Condition class has these methods.

Method Description
Invoke Evaluates a particular check. The details of how the method evaluates a particular check in a CIM context are described by the non-abstract CIM_Check subclasses.

Properties

The Win32_Condition class has these properties.

Caption

Data type: string

Access type: Read-only

Short textual description of the object.

CheckID

Data type: string

Access type: Read-only

Identifier used in conjunction with other keys to uniquely identify the check.

CheckMode

Data type: boolean

Access type: Read-only

Condition is expected to exist in the environment. When TRUE, the condition is expected to exist (for example, a file is expected to be on a system), so the Invoke method is expected to return TRUE.

Condition

Data type: string

Access type: Read-only

Conditional statement that evaluates to TRUE or FALSE to determine whether the Level value should be applied to the associated software feature.

Description

Data type: string

Access type: Read-only

Description of the object.

Feature

Data type: string

Access type: Read-only

Name of the feature within the associated product to which this condition applies.

Level

Data type: uint16

Access type: Read-only

Install level for the associated software feature if Condition evaluates to TRUE.

Name

Data type: string

Access type: Read-only

Name used to identify the software element.

SoftwareElementID

Data type: string

Access type: Read-only

Identifier for the software element.

SoftwareElementState

Data type: uint16

Access type: Read-only

State of a software element.

Value Meaning
1
Deployable
2
Installable
3
Executable
4
Running

Version

Data type: string

Access type: Read-only

Version of the software element. Values should be in the form [Major].[Minor].[Revision] or [Major].[Minor][letter][revision].

Remarks

The Win32_Condition class is derived from CIM_Check.
